What is a Car Key Locksmith?
A car key locksmith, also called an automotive locksmith, concentrates on the development, replacement, and repair of car keys and locks. They have the expertise to handle a large range of automotive security problems, from conventional lock-and-key systems to innovative electronic keyless entry systems. These experts are geared up with the most current tools and innovations to help with numerous key-related emergency situations and maintenance needs.

The evolution of automotive innovation has actually significantly affected the field of locksmithing. Modern cars frequently include advanced security systems, including:
Transponder Keys: These keys include a chip that communicates with the car's computer system to enable ignition. Reprogramming these keys requires specific equipment and know-how.Remote Control Keys: Key fobs with built-in transmitters that lock and open the car from another location. These need to be synchronized with the car's receiver.Keyless Entry Systems: Some cars utilize wise keys or keyless entry systems, where the key fob does not need to be physically placed into the lock.
Car key locksmiths need to remain updated with these developments to provide reliable services. They invest in continuous training and the most recent tools to guarantee they can deal with any circumstance that develops.

Q: What should I do if I lose my car keys?
A: Contact an expert car key locksmith immediately. They can supply a replicate key and, if needed, reprogram the car's immobilizer system to guarantee your vehicle stays protected.
Q: How long does it require to get a new car key?
A: The time can differ depending upon the complexity of the key and the locksmith's devices. For easy keys, it can take as low as 20-30 minutes, while advanced keys may use up to a few hours.
Q: Are all car key locksmith professionals the very same?
A: No, the quality and competence of locksmith professionals can vary substantially. Try to find a locksmith who is accredited, accredited, and has a great reputation.
Q: Can a car key locksmith aid with a jammed lock?
A: Yes, car key locksmith professionals are trained to repair and replace jammed or malfunctioning locks. They can also offer guidance on preventing future concerns.
Q: Is it legal to make a copy of my car key?
A: Yes, it is legal to make a copy of your car key. However, it's essential to utilize a credible locksmith who will confirm your ownership of the vehicle before producing a duplicate.
